With such a solution, the necessity of a central pressure tube projecting in the washroom is eliminated to direct the liquid to a flush arm arranged at the top of the tube. However, in these known solutions, the washing basket must be placed in a determined working position. At very varying sizes for the dishwasher, it is desirable to move the basket in the height direction in the dishwasher so that it can be optimally utilized. In order to make better use of the washing room, it is also necessary that the rinsing arm is moved with the basket and that its connection to the rinsing system is adjustable according to the height chosen for the basket.

According to this technique, a sleeve-like piece 20 is threaded on one pipe which is threaded over the other pipe. When the sleeve is removed from the riser, the pipe ends are open and liquid can spray out through the riser as this has no valve that closes when the sleeve is pulled away.

This ensures that both valves are closed when the end piece is pulled away from the riser. This means that liquid cannot flow out of the riser, which is thus completely closed. This allows the machine to operate at extra high pressure in the lower rinse arm. Thus, if you take the basket over, you can have an extra large washing effect in the sub-basket. The height-setting setting of the flush arm may be stepwise or infinitely designed, but is determined by a coupling device on a pressure tube at one wall of the washroom. The coupling device has a detachable connection between the pressure pipe and a cord to the flushing arm and holds the connection tight when the flushing arm is in a working position at one of several selectable levels in the washing room.

The upper end of the riser has a pair of one-way valves 17, 18 arranged at various levels and (in the example shown in Fig. 2) is formed as a pair of valve plates 19 which from the inside of springs 20 are pressed against valve holes 21 in the riser. The upper basket 14 has on the underside a bearing 25 22 for the rinsing arm 11, which bearing has a lead 23 extending rearward along the underside of the basket.
